Wholesale Florists – Key Suppliers of Flowers Worldwide
Flowers, of course, are the number one ingredient or resource for florists. Without flowers a florist wouldn’t be in business. So, it comes without surprise that buying flowers is a major task for any florist. Where do florists get their flowers? Who do they trust as suppliers? Most retail florists buy their flowers from wholesale florists.
A wholesale florist purchases flowers in bulk directly from flower growers or flower farms. Wholesale florists then offer the flowers for sale to retail florists. Wholesale florists can either be local to retail florists and sell their bulk flowers at established wholesale flower markets or be remote (i.e., located in another city or state) and provide direct shipping and delivery of their bulk flowers to retail florists.
A fairly recent phenomenon is the advent of internet wholesale florists who provide their flowers for sale directly over the internet. Just google the term wholesale florists and you’ll find a plethora of wholesale flower suppliers.
When choosing to do business with wholesale florists, it is important for florists to understand the entire flower supply chain including shipment and receiving dates. There are primary shipment days from flower farms (Friday’s and Monday’s with deliveries to the wholesale florist on Sunday’s and Wednesday’s), however shipments do occur pretty much everyday.
The freshest flowers are those that have been harvested, shipped, and processed according to cold storage supply chain and shipping standards. Choose wholesale florists that partner with their suppliers (flower growers and flower farms) who follow the cold storage supply chain and shipping standards.
